bioAffinity Technologies Secures $3.25 Million Offering Support

bioAffinity Technologies Opens New Funding Opportunities
WallachBeth Capital LLC, an esteemed provider of capital markets and execution services, has recently played a crucial role in facilitating a significant financial offering by bioAffinity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: BIAF). This biotechnology firm is dedicated to developing noninvasive tests aimed at early-stage cancer detection. The current offering is a strategic move to raise a total of $3.25 million, designed to support the company's innovative healthcare solutions.
Structure of the Offering
The offering comprises approximately 10,156,250 shares of Common Stock or pre-funded warrants, along with warrants that initially allow for the purchase of up to 15,234,375 shares of Common Stock. This comprehensive package provides investors with an attractive entry point, as the public offering price is set at $0.32 per share or pre-funded warrant, accompanied by the respective warrants.
